Weather in June

June, the first month of the summer in Early Branch, is a hot month, with temperature in the range of an average low of 70.9°F (21.6°C) and an average high of 88.7°F (31.5°C).

Temperature

As Early Branch welcomes June, the average high-temperature sees a modest rise, transitioning from a moderately hot 82.2°F (27.9°C) in May to a tropical 88.7°F (31.5°C). During June, Early Branch experiences a consistent low-temperature average of 70.9°F (21.6°C).

Heat index

For most parts of June, the heat index is evaluated at a blistering 105.8°F (41°C). Undertake extra safety actions, heat cramps and heat exhaustion are expected. Heatstroke may result from lengthy activity.
Regarding the heat index, one should be aware it's determined by shaded settings and mild winds. The presence of direct sunlight can raise the heat index values by up to 15 Fahrenheit (8 Celsius) degrees.
Note: The heat index, also known as 'real feel' or 'apparent temperature', integrates the air's temperature and its humidity to showcase the felt temperature by people. The effect is personal, with varied weather perceptions among individuals due to differences in body mass, stature, and physical activity. Understand that direct sun rays can influence the weather's impact, leading to an increase in the heat index by 15 Fahrenheit (8 Celsius) degrees. Heat index values are highly critical for babies and toddlers. Children often fail to recognize the requirement to rest and rehydrate. Thirst, being a late symptom of dehydration, underlines the importance of maintaining hydration, especially during ongoing physical activities.
Evaporating sweat, thanks to perspiration, acts as a natural air conditioner for the human body. An increase in relative humidity hinders the body's normal cooling function by reducing evaporation, thereby decreasing the rate of body cooling and enhancing the sense of warmth. When the body is unable to balance heat gain, its temperature elevates, which may induce thermal illnesses.

Humidity

In June, the average relative humidity in Early Branch is 75%.

Rainfall

In Early Branch, during June, the rain falls for 15.3 days and regularly aggregates up to 2.05" (52mm) of precipitation. Throughout the year, there are 138.1 rainfall days, and 18.98" (482mm) of precipitation is accumulated.

Daylight

The month with the longest days is June, with an average of 14h and 18min of daylight.
On the first day of June, sunrise is at 6:16 am and sunset at 8:27 pm. On the last day of the month, sunrise is at 6:19 am and sunset at 8:35 pm EDT.

Sunshine

The average sunshine in June in Early Branch is 10.6h.

UV index

June through August, with an average maximum UV index of 7, are months with the highest UV index. A UV Index estimate of 6 to 7 represents a high health risk from unprotected exposure to Sun's UV rays for ordinary individuals.
Note: An average maximum UV index of 7 in June leads to these recommendations:
Take precautions and utilize sun safety practices. Protection against skin and eye damage is required. The Sun's UV radiation is most intense from 10 a.m. to 4 p.m. Try to avoid direct sun exposure during these hours. Clothes that are both tight-knit and comfortably loose are prime choices for sun protection.
